[Objective] This paper explores the theoretical foundation and practical experience of buidling a computational Chinese grammar system. [Methods] This study discussed the development process of the Mandarin Grammar Online (ManGO), an Head-driven Phrase Structure Grammar (HPSG) system with Minimal Recursion Semantics. It built the lexicon and hierarchy rules for the idiosyncratic structures of the Chinese grammar. [Results] The successful development of the ManGO system showed that the HPSG was an ideal theoretical framework for the Chinese computational grammar applications. [Limitations] ManGO was still underdeveloped, and it was not able to examine this system’s coverage with large-scale natural language data. [Conclusions] ManGO connects the theories of formal and computational linguistics, therefore, it becomes the foundation to develop large scale resource grammar.
